The transmission is a crucial mechanical bridge between the engine and the road, and can cause a significant breakdown or injury. The Grand Cherokee, the worst Jeep model in terms of resale value, experiences transmission problems documented across multiple recall filings. NHTSA Recall 16V-240 was issued in 2016, concerning certain 2014–2015 Jeep Grand Cherokees with an eight-speed automatic transmission and monostable gear selector prone to dangerous rollaways. In 2024, Jeep recalled another 206,502 SUVs due to a faulty ABS sensor that could allow the vehicle to start and shift out of Park without the driver pressing the brake pedal. The Nissan Pathfinder's CVT problems are documented in its own filings with NHSSA. Ford Explorer's transmission problems are not singular, but are a cascade of different defects.
